Hello SmileI'm having some troubles running IRAF and was wondering if anyone could help me.So after a bit of tinkering, I've installed IRAF (downloaded from macsingularity.org) as well as X11 and all the other bits and pieces on my laptop. It's a Mac Powerbook G4 (PPC) running OS X 10.4.11 (Tiger).xgterm opens fine, and allows me to login to IRAF. Everything works fine until I try to open any graphics in xgterm -- then it closes unexpectedly, dropping me back into the X11 window with an arcane looking error message:
[code:1:d8fe959ca2]Error in message to server, line 6: send: could not find object gterm
while excecuting
"send gterm setGterm"
xgterm Xt error: Shell widget gterm-iraf has zero width and/or height[/code:1:d8fe959ca2]The specific package I'm trying to use is noao > onedspec > splotCan anyone offer any advice? Do I need to download and install "gterm"? Any help would be much appreciated! Cheers!

This reminded me of a problem I was having last summer. I posted the solution on http://iparrizar.mnstate.edu/~juan/urania/2007/08/09/hint-resolving-xgterm-problems-outside-of-iraf/. In a nutshell. I would check your login.cl file and any other cl scripts you run in IRAF and make sure they DO not execute a [code:1:13714a682b]stty xterm[/code:1:13714a682b]I found that replacing it with [code:1:13714a682b]stty xgterm[/code:1:13714a682b]fixed everything.

Thanks for the quick reply -- but I'm afraid my login.cl script was already set to stty xgterm, and it's the only .cl script I've set up. ConfusedEDIT-- Forget that!
For some reason there were two login.cl files. I've fixed the other one now and it works just fine. Thanks a lot! Big Grin
